Profile
Operates by originating, selectively acquiring, financing, and managing commercial-real-estate credit investments, chiefly senior mortgages. The internally managed REIT also has selective mezzanine, preferred-equity, and net-leased-real-estate exposure from a platform assembled from predecessor portfolios.
Built from a combination of predecessor real-estate portfolios, the platform originates, selectively acquires, finances, and manages commercial-real-estate debt. Senior mortgages are its primary strategy, alongside selective mezzanine loans, preferred equity, and net-leased properties.
The lending platform is internally managed with dedicated management and operating functions following a transition from its external manager. Key offices are in New York and Los Angeles. It operates with REIT tax treatment.
Recent portfolio work has centered on resolving legacy REO and watchlist-loan positions and redeploying proceeds as new originations resumed. The operating subsidiary holds substantially all of its assets and liabilities.
